FranklinWH launches new home battery setup

FranklinWH has launched the aPower S home battery, Meter Adapter Controller (MAC) and aHub extension as part of its latest additions to the FranklinWH System.

“Homeowners are looking for energy solutions that can address increasingly complex challenges,” said Gary Lam, CEO of FranklinWH. “That’s exactly what we are bringing with our latest innovations. Attendees at the show will witness how these innovations redefine home energy systems.”

The aPower S battery offers 15 kWh of usable capacity, with a 15-year or 60-MWh throughput warranty.

The MAC enables easy system interconnection by directly connecting to the meter socket adapter (MSA) and the electrical meter, avoiding panel overhauls and significantly reducing installation time and costs. It also allows for predictive load management and can regulate voltage and frequency levels.

The aHub integrates additional sources and loads into a single, unified intelligent solution. IT also can accomodate up to three solar arrays with a maximum capacity of 24 kW, and it enables solar integration up to 165 ft away, overcoming the limitation of roof space.
